Battery life for a hand-held computer is normally distrituted and has a population standard deviation of 7 hours. Suppose you need to estimate a confidence interval estimate at the 95% level of confidence for the mean life of these batteries. Determine the sample size required to have a margin of error of 0.585 hours. Round up to the nearest whole number.

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:

A sample size of 551 is required.

Step-by-step explanation:

We have that to find our [tex]\alpha[/tex] level, that is the subtraction of 1 by the confidence interval divided by 2. So:

[tex]\alpha = \frac{1 - 0.95}{2} = 0.025[/tex]

Now, we have to find z in the Ztable as such z has a pvalue of [tex]1 - \alpha[/tex].

That is z with a pvalue of [tex]1 - 0.025 = 0.975[/tex], so Z = 1.96.

Now, find the margin of error M as such

[tex]M = z\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}[/tex]

In which [tex]\sigma[/tex] is the standard deviation of the population and n is the size of the sample.

Population standard deviation of 7 hours.

This means that [tex]\sigma = 7[/tex]

Determine the sample size required to have a margin of error of 0.585 hours.

This is n for which M = 0.585. So

[tex]M = z\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}[/tex]

[tex]0.585 = 1.96\frac{7}{\sqrt{n}}[/tex]

[tex]0.585\sqrt{n} = 1.96*7[/tex]

[tex]\sqrt{n} = \frac{1.96*7}{0.585}[/tex]

[tex](\sqrt{n})^2 = (\frac{1.96*7}{0.585})^2[/tex]

[tex]n = 550.04[/tex]

Rounding up(as for a sample of 550 the margir of error will be a bit above the desired target):

A sample size of 551 is required.

Find the critical value t for the confidence level c= 0.98 and sample size n=7.
Click the icon to view the t-distribution table.
=(Round to the nearest thousandth as needed.)

Answers

Answer:

The critical value is T = 3.143.

Step-by-step explanation:

The first step to solve this problem is finding how many degrees of freedom, we have. This is the sample size subtracted by 1. So

df = 7 - 1 = 6

98% confidence interval

Now, we have to find a value of T, which is found looking at the t table, with 6 degrees of freedom(y-axis) and a confidence level of [tex]1 - \frac{1 - 0.98}{2} = 0.99[/tex]. So we have T = 3.143.

The critical value is T = 3.143.
